Another critical aspect I emphasize to clients is the difference between hosted and integrated gateways. Hosted solutions redirect customers to the payment provider's page, which can disrupt the shopping experience but often offer better security. Integrated solutions keep customers on your site but require more technical expertise. Comparing Three Major Gateway Approaches

Based on my extensive testing and implementation experience, I typically compare three approaches: all-in-one platforms like Shopify Payments, specialized providers like Stripe, and enterprise solutions like Adyen. Each serves different business needs. All-in-one platforms work best for businesses prioritizing simplicity and quick setup—I've found they're ideal for new entrepreneurs launching their first online store. Specialized providers like Stripe offer exceptional flexibility and developer-friendly APIs; in my practice, I recommend these for businesses with unique requirements or those planning significant customization. Enterprise solutions provide comprehensive global capabilities but come with higher costs and complexity; I reserve these recommendations for established businesses processing over $1 million annually.

My Step-by-Step Implementation Framework

Based on my experience, I recommend following this structured approach: First, establish clear success metrics—what does "success" look like for your implementation? Second, create a detailed technical specification document that covers every integration point. Third, develop in a staging environment that mirrors production as closely as possible. Fourth, conduct comprehensive testing across devices, browsers, and payment methods. Fifth, implement monitoring and alerting before going live. Sixth, execute a phased rollout starting with a small percentage of transactions. Seventh, continuously optimize based on real-world performance data. Essential Security Measures Every Business Should Implement

Based on my experience with security audits and implementations, I recommend five essential measures: First, PCI DSS compliance is non-negotiable—I've seen too many businesses face severe penalties for non-compliance. Second, tokenization should be implemented to replace sensitive data with unique identifiers. Third, strong encryption must protect data in transit and at rest. Fourth, regular security assessments and penetration testing should be conducted. Fifth, fraud detection systems need to be calibrated to your specific business model. Design Principles for High-Converting Checkouts

From my experience redesigning checkout flows for clients, I've developed five key design principles: First, minimize form fields to only what's absolutely necessary—each additional field increases abandonment risk. Second, provide clear progress indicators so customers know where they are in the process. Third, offer multiple payment options without overwhelming choice. Fourth, design for mobile first, as over 60% of e-commerce transactions now occur on mobile devices. Fifth, incorporate subtle brand elements that reinforce trust and connection. Key Considerations for Global Payment Implementation

Based on my experience with international expansions, I focus on five critical areas: First, payment method preferences vary dramatically by region—while credit cards dominate in the U.S., digital wallets like Alipay are essential in China, and bank transfers are preferred in Germany. Second, currency handling requires careful strategy regarding conversion rates, fees, and display. Third, regulatory compliance differs across jurisdictions, with varying requirements for data storage, consumer protection, and tax collection. Fourth, fraud patterns and prevention approaches need regional adaptation. Fifth, customer support must accommodate different languages, time zones, and cultural expectations. In 2024, I worked with a specialty food company based in California that wanted to expand to Japan, Germany, and Australia simultaneously. Each market presented unique challenges: Japan required integration with Konbini (convenience store) payments, which allow customers to pay offline after ordering online. Germany needed support for SEPA direct debits and invoice payments (Rechnungskauf), which are deeply embedded in consumer expectations. Australia required specific compliance with Australian Consumer Law and integration with local payment methods like POLi. Key Trends Shaping the Future of Payments

Based on my analysis of industry developments and early adopter implementations, I identify several trends that will significantly impact e-commerce payments in the coming years. First, embedded finance is transforming how payments integrate with broader customer experiences—think of buying now, paying later options that feel like natural extensions of the shopping journey rather than separate financial products. Second, decentralized finance and blockchain-based payments are maturing beyond cryptocurrency speculation to offer real advantages in certain use cases, particularly for cross-border transactions and micropayments. Third, biometric authentication is moving from novelty to mainstream, offering both enhanced security and improved user experience. Fourth, real-time payments are becoming the expectation rather than the exception, changing how businesses manage cash flow and customer expectations.
